Recognition Robotics, Inc. is a focused PatentsView assignee: 14 CPC subclasses with 60% of grants classified under G01B (Measuring Length, Thickness OR Similar Linear DIMENSIONS; Measuring ANGLES; Measuring AREAS; Measuring Irregularities OF Surfaces OR Contours). Peak complete grant year is 2018 (5 grants) versus a trough of 2 in 2017. By volume, Recognition sits between Raytheon Cyber Products, LLC and Reoxcyn LLC.
